The guiding questions for this activity are,”How does surface tension affect movement in liquids and how many drops of water can a penny hold before the water slides off?” In this activity, students experiment with water striders and placing water drops on a penny. A detailed science behind the activity is provided. Students will also learn about cohesion. Before beginning this activity, we recommend you read Chapters 9 and 11 which are in this book selection.
